Are centralized solar inverters expensive
Central Inverters: Cost $3,000 to $8,000 (for large-scale systems). Designed for commercial and industrial projects or large homes (10+ kW), they handle high-energy loads efficiently with centralized control. . Small Residential Systems (3-5 kW): These systems typically use inverters ranging from 3 to 5 kW, with prices ranging from $1,000 to $2,000. Large Residential/Small. . Lower capital expenditure (CAPEX): While string inverter costs have come down, central inverters are usually cheaper upfront (in dollars-per-watt). Central inverters play a critical role in utility-scale solar photovoltaic (PV) installations, converting the direct current (DC) generated by large solar arrays into alternating current (AC) for grid distribution. These inverters are designed to handle high power levels and operate efficiently in. . There are three primary tiers of PV inverters: microinverters, string inverters, and central inverters. MSP is the minimum price (with inflation adjustment) that a company can charge for its product or service in a balanced, competitive market and remain financially solvent for the long term, assuming that each of the company's input costs also represent the MSP for that cost element.
